Overview
- Jason Lublin departs Endeavor after nearly 20 years as CFO, COO and IMG College president to lead WTSL’s investment strategy
- WTSL secured a $250 million backing from Silver Lake following its go-private deal with Endeavor earlier this year
- At Endeavor, Lublin managed over 30 acquisitions and partnerships, including the William Morris Agency merger and deals for IMG, UFC and On Location Experiences
- He will also serve as president and chief operating officer of Win Sports Group, the professional football representation arm spun out of WME Group
- WTSL’s early portfolio includes a strategic stake in Peyton Manning’s Omaha Productions and a joint venture with Universal Music Group
